Problems solved by technology

[0004] At present, in the manufacturing method of melt-blown nonwoven materials on the market, when the material is mixed, melted and stirred, the stirring effect is poor, resulting in uneven distribution between the components, which affects the melt-blown effect; In the process, because the temperature of the fiber will drop suddenly when it leaves the die, if the temperature drops under the action of traction, the continuity of the fiber will be reduced, which will affect the forming effect of the melt-blown cloth, and it will also be in the melt-blown die. The outlet of the outlet forms a node, which affects the subsequent processing operations

Abstract

The invention discloses a method for manufacturing a melt-blown nonwoven material, and aims to provide a method for manufacturing a melt-blown nonwoven material with good molding effect, strong structural stability and strong fiber continuity. Select, set the mixed material to polypropylene, fluoropolymer and electret, control the forming and electret effect of the melt-blown nonwoven material fiber, improve the overall forming effect of the melt-blown cloth, and have strong practicability. And in order to improve the molding effect of the electret masterbatch, by taking 50-80 parts of polypropylene resin in 200 parts of polypropylene resin and fluoropolymer, electret, lubricant and antioxidant after uniform blending, when extruding , repeated uniform stirring to improve the effect of uniform distribution of fluorine-containing polymers and electrets, ensuring good molding and electret effects, strong practicability, and simple structure. The present invention is suitable for the technical field of medical supplies manufacturing .

Description

technical field [0001] The invention relates to the technical field of manufacturing medical supplies, more specifically, it relates to a method for manufacturing melt-blown nonwoven materials. Background technique [0002] Traditional melt-blown nonwoven materials need to ensure the surface roughness of the fibers, the stability of the crystal structure and the size of the fiber web, and the uniform stability of the electret. [0003] The traditional manufacturing method of melt-blown nonwoven materials needs to select the material first, then mix some materials, select the electret masterbatch, and finally mix the electret masterbatch with the remaining materials to form Melt blown polypropylene nonwoven.
